    Quote Originally Posted by Tridus View Post
    I don't really understand what is they're doing and why they felt it was better than the glamour log that pretty much everyone is begging for.
    From what I've gathered, it's somewhat similar to the Transmog system WoW utilizes. You convert gear into "prisms," which sit in a separate UI, thus freeing up space. You'll then be allowed to use those "prisms" to create Ensembles. In theory, you should be able to turn those on and off, thus allowing Paladin and Dark Knight to have unique glamours. That all said, the ten slot limitation is straight up dumb. That doesn't even cover half the amount of jobs and classes we have.

    I get the impression they don't want to outright kill the current glamour system, which say, 50 slots would. Sadly, the devs seem to have this weird desire to cling to everything.

    For anyone that has played Diablo 3 why couldn't square just make something like that? Go to npc that keeps a window (and try on window) of all gear looks in the game that unlocks as the character levels up. Green/blue/unique/untradeable gets unlocked by owning it (can be trashed afterwards). Just pay gil and boom that slot now looks like x gear. It even has a dye option to it.
